Question
(1) A company in Scotland bottles sparkling water. The fixed cost per month to produce bottled water is
$35,000, and the variable cost is $0.2 per bottle. Price is related to demand according to the following
equation:
v = 4,000 – 1.1p
Determine the optimal price using a nonlinear profit analysis.
(2) A tailor on Savile Row is producing suits. The fixed cost per month producing suits is $13,000, and the
variable cost is $140 per suit. Price is related to demand, according to the following equation.
v = 600 – 1.5p
Determine the optimal price using a nonlinear profit analysis.
